How do you treat periodontal disease?
Periodontal diseases are chronic and require fast action. Our services, including root planing & scaling, periodontal cleanings, laser therapy, and antibiotics, can help control this condition. Surgery may be necessary in serious cases.

1. How often should adults go to the dentist for cleanings?
Most healthy adults with healthy gums should visit the dentist every six months for a preventative cleaning and checkup. Adults with a history of periodontal therapy, require a periodontal maintenance appointment to manage their gum disease and have to visit their dentist more frequently. 2. What’s the best way to prevent cavities and gum disease?
A healthy diet, daily brushing and flossing, and twice-a-year dental visits are key. Sunnyslope Dental Care also offers preventive treatments like sealants and fluoride to help keep your smile healthy for life.
3. When should my child first visit the dentist?
It’s best to schedule your child’s first dental appointment by their first birthday or when their first tooth appears. At Sunnyslope Dental Care, we help children build strong oral health habits from day one.

4. Do I really need X-rays at my dental checkup?
Yes, though the frequency needed depends on your personal risk factors. Dental X-rays help detect issues that aren’t visible during a regular exam, like cavities between teeth or bone loss. We use modern, low-radiation technology at Sunnyslope Dental Care for your safety and peace of mind.
5. What causes bad breath?
Many factors can contribute to bad breath or halitosis including dental plaque, gum disease, dry mouth, diet, smoking, and other medical issues. If you have concerns about bad breath talk to one of our doctors at Sunnyslope Dental Care.

6. What causes bleeding gums when I brush?
Bleeding gums are a common sign of gum inflammation or gum disease. In its early stage, gum disease is known as gingivitis; if left untreated, it can progress to periodontitis, a more serious condition.
